1.0.1 • Published 3 years ago
nv-facutil-simple-log v1.0.1
nv-facutil-simple-log
- simple log with color
install
- npm install nv-facutil-simple-log
usage
example
> var x = require("nv-facutil-simple-log")
> x.setVerbosityLevelInfo()
> x.getVerbosityLevel()
5
> x.info('abc')
Info: abc
> x.warn('abc')
Warning: abc
> x.assert(false,'abc')
abc
Uncaught Error: abc
at unreachable (/opt/JS/NV5_/nv-facutil_/pkgs/nv-facutil-simple-log/index.js:57:9)
at Object.assert (/opt/JS/NV5_/nv-facutil_/pkgs/nv-facutil-simple-log/index.js:63:7)
>
APIS
{
VerbosityLevel: { ERRORS: 0, WARNINGS: 1, INFOS: 5 },
setVerbosityLevel: [Function: setVerbosityLevel],
setVerbosityLevelError: [Function: setVerbosityLevelError],
setVerbosityLevelWarning: [Function: setVerbosityLevelWarning],
setVerbosityLevelInfo: [Function: setVerbosityLevelInfo],
getVerbosityLevel: [Function: getVerbosityLevel],
info: [Function: info],
warn: [Function: warn],
unreachable: [Function: unreachable],
assert: [Function: assert],
show: [Function: show],
paint_ansi8: [Function: paint_ansi8],
paint_ansi8_underscore: [Function: paint_ansi8_underscore],
paint_ansi256: [Function: paint_ansi256],
log_ansi8: [Function: log_ansi8],
log_ansi8_undersore: [Function: log_ansi8_undersore],
log_ansi256: [Function: log_ansi256]
}
LICENSE
- ISC
1.0.1
3 years ago